PhoneView for Mac is feature-rich, lightweight, and well worth the price. One feature which we think some Mac users may miss is the ability to Quick Look items by pressing the space bar. A really nice touch is the ability to save conversations from Messages.app as text or PDF files for desktop viewing and backup. In addition to letting you explore and back up media files stored on your iOS device, this app also lets you extract data such as contacts, call logs, notes, bookmarks, and Web browsing history. In terms of transfer speeds, the program averages around 10MB/s. You can drag and drop files between the app and the Finder or the Desktop with ease, but you cannot drag multiple items. If checked in Preferences, the "Advanced Disk Mode" will show the entire file system on a jail-broken device, allowing complete access to all system files. Out of the box, the program displays a Media folder where you can store files. Both the trial and full versions of the app can display the contents of iOS devices, but the trial version limits the number of items shown. PhoneView for Mac installs quickly and sports a bland but intuitive interface. You'll like its streamlined design and drag-and-drop functions. Since it features iTunes-like backup functionality, it's capable of completely replacing iTunes as a device manager. PhoneView for Mac gives you instant access to your iOS device, enabling you to back up and explore any type of content stored on it, including media files, call logs, text messages, contacts, and more.
